Skin laxity is one of the biggest reasons the jawline loses definition. As collagen levels decline, the lower face may appear heavier or softer.
Modern tightening treatments help stimulate collagen beneath the skin. Over time, this creates firmer and tighter facial contours.
These treatments are often used for:
Many people choose these procedures because they support gradual improvement instead of sudden changes.

Some people naturally have stronger jaw muscles. Teeth grinding and jaw clenching can also make the lower face appear wider.
Jaw slimming treatments help soften the appearance of bulky jaw muscles. This creates a narrower and more balanced lower face.
This approach is one of the most common methods for face slimming in Singapore because it can improve facial proportions without surgery.

Excess fullness around the chin and lower face can blur facial contours.
Non-surgical fat reduction methods help reduce stubborn pockets of fat beneath the chin or along the jawline. These treatments are often combined with skin tightening for more balanced results.
